The actual decision is not nearly panels

Homeowners frequently focus initially on panel brand names. That makes sense. Panels show up, and manufacturers spend a great deal of money marketing effectiveness, toughness, and look. But the majority of long-term results are shaped by system style and installer skills as opposed to by small distinctions in panel wattage.

A trustworthy solar provider need to check out your shading account, roof age, major service panel, attic conditions, and annual intake prior to recommending system dimension. If a sales representative offers you a quote after only eying satellite images and asking for your regular monthly bill, that is inadequate. Satellite tools work, however they do not disclose every little thing. Roofing obstructions, avenue https://www.google.com/maps?cid=10599803635128617921&g_mp=CiVnb29nbGUubWFwcy5wbGFjZXMudjEuUGxhY2VzLkdldFBsYWNlEAMYASAF&hl=en&gl=US&source=embed routes, structural issues, and solution tools limitations can impact both price and performance.

Good solar panel providers also understand that savings are not the like manufacturing. A system can produce a solid variety of kilowatt-hours and still underperform financially if it is sized inadequately for your use pattern or paired with the incorrect financing structure. That is especially appropriate in The golden state, where energy payment regulations and time-based rates have altered the business economics of solar compared with a few years ago.

A trustworthy provider will certainly speak about those compromises simply. They will not pretend every house owner must install the biggest system feasible. Often a smaller sized system with a battery makes even more sense. Often solar alone still works well. Occasionally the roofing system needs to be changed first, also if that delays the project.

Start with your roof covering, your expense, and your timeline

Before evaluating solar providers, obtain clear on the condition of your home. A solar system is anticipated to rest on your roofing system for years. If the roof has just a couple of years left, the most inexpensive option is frequently not to continue immediately. Eliminating and re-installing panels later adds labor and complexity, and service warranty sychronisation can end up being messy when contractors and installers factor at each other.

Your energy background matters just as much. A major supplier needs to ask for current electrical expenses, ideally covering twelve months, due to the fact that one month tells nearly nothing. Seasonality matters. A house that utilizes really little electrical energy in springtime yet spikes in summer as a result of a/c has a various solar account from a house with constant year-round use. Add an electric lorry, pool pump, or planned heat pump conversion, and the sizing discussion adjustments again.

Timeline is one more overlooked variable. If you recognize you want to replace a heating and cooling system, purchase an EV, or convert from gas to electrical devices within a year or two, inform the installer now. One of one of the most common remorses I hear is from home owners that sized the system just for present use, after that discovered themselves short after an EV purchase. Expanding later on can be possible, but it is hardly ever as simple or affordable as doing the layout properly the initial time.

What divides solid solar providers from refined sales teams

The ideal solar companies do not just sell confidence. They reveal their work.

A qualified proposal need to clarify predicted annual production, system dimension in kilowatts, panel count, inverter approach, devices brand names, approximated first-year output, and assumptions behind savings estimates. If the financial savings number depends on utility inflation, rate changing, battery dispatch actions, or excellent use timing, the supplier ought to say so directly.

Pay close attention to just how concerns are dealt with. A seasoned specialist can describe why they picked microinverters versus a string inverter, just how color influences manufacturing, what occurs if one panel underperforms, and exactly how checking jobs after setup. A weak salesman will certainly often pivot back to financing or tax motivations without totally responding to the technological point.

The difference ends up being evident when you ask awkward inquiries. Ask what is left out from the quote. Ask what might trigger a modification order. Ask that manages service phone calls three years from now. Ask whether they make use of internal crews or subcontractors, and if subcontractors are entailed, that owns quality control. The best carriers address clearly and without defensiveness.

The quote that looks least expensive usually is not

Solar pricing is seldom apples to apples. One quote might consist of premium panels, a primary panel upgrade, attic conduit transmitting, critter guard, and a manufacturing assurance. One more may leave out numerous of those items and depend on hopeful assumptions. Initially glimpse, the second quote success. On a total price basis, it may not.

The information that are entitled to analysis typically conceal in ordinary sight. System dimension can differ by a few panels. Production assumptions can vary depending upon the modeling software program inputs. Financing can extend terms long enough to make a high-cost job feel budget friendly. Dealer costs on financed systems can substantially affect total task price, also when the regular monthly payment seems attractive.

That is why home owners must ask for money cost, funded rate, estimated annual production, and the basis for utility financial savings quotes. If a service provider resists providing a clean breakdown, that is a warning sign. Transparency ought to not be negotiable.

Here are 5 points worth contrasting in every proposition:

Total mounted cost, including any electric upgrades and add-ons Expected yearly manufacturing in kilowatt-hours, not just buck cost savings Equipment version numbers and warranty terms Assumptions behind the payback or month-to-month financial savings approximate Post-installation support, monitoring, and service action process

That short contrast often exposes greater than a lengthy sales presentation.

Equipment high quality matters, yet fit issues more

There is no single best panel or inverter for every house. Premium equipment can make sense, especially on roofs with restricted useful room, yet there are several trustworthy products on the marketplace. The much better inquiry is whether the system style fits your home.

For instance, if your roofing has multiple small aircrafts and partial color throughout parts of the day, module-level power electronics might be worth the extra cost. If your roofing system is huge, open, and primarily unshaded, an easier arrangement might do well and minimize equipment complexity. If aesthetics issue due to the fact that the panels deal with the road, the carrier should talk about panel look, channel routing, and design proportion, not simply wattage.

Battery storage is entitled to the very same practical lens. Some homeowners are informed that a battery is necessary for every person. That is not constantly real. A battery can offer backup power and assistance handle time-based utility costs, but it likewise increases the job price considerably. For a homeowner with steady grid solution and small night tons, solar without storage space may still be the far better financial action. For someone who desires durability throughout outages or expects to amaze more of the home, a battery may be worth major consideration.

A reputable supplier will provide those options truthfully, with compromises, not pressure.

Reputation is useful, yet recommendations are better

Online examines aid, however they just inform part of the tale. The majority of house owners leave testimonials right after installment, when the panels look excellent and the project feels interesting. Fewer testimonials capture what occurs 2 or 3 years later, when service requires occur, keeping track of problems appear, or warranty concerns come up.

That is why referrals matter. Ask to speak with recent consumers and, preferably, one client whose system has actually been running for a couple of years. Ask whether the project stayed on routine, whether adjustment orders were reasonable, and exactly how the company reacted when something did not go flawlessly. Every professional has periodic missteps. What matters is whether they handled them professionally.

Look for uniformity in the comments. If a number of clients claim the install was tidy, interaction was punctual, and manufacturing matched assumptions, that is purposeful. If multiple customers mention hold-ups, payment confusion, or difficulty getting to anybody after appointing, take that seriously.

The agreement ought to be legible without a magnifying glass

A solar agreement does not require to be short, but it does need to be reasonable. You should understand exactly what you are purchasing, what triggers surcharges, what the approximated schedule appears like, and which party is responsible for each step. If the agreement feels slippery, it probably is.

Pay certain interest to efficiency language. Some firms supply approximated production only. Others might use more powerful guarantees. Neither technique is automatically better, however the distinction ought to be clear. Service warranties additionally need careful reading. Panel warranties, inverter warranties, craftsmanship warranties, and roof penetration service warranties may all originate from different parties or have various durations.

Cancellation terms, repayment milestones, funding disclosures, and change-order procedures all should have a close appearance. If you are rushed to sign due to the fact that a promotion runs out tonite, go back. High-pressure timing is one of the oldest techniques in home services, and it is seldom an indication of a high-quality company.

Permits, examinations, and energy authorization belong to the product

Homeowners frequently assume the mount itself is the task. Actually, the complete job consists of design, allows, design testimonial if required, installment, evaluation, utility interconnection, and system activation. A supplier that is smooth just on sales day however disordered with the management phases can develop weeks or months of unneeded delay.

Ask exactly how they handle permitting and utility documents. Ask what a regular timeline appears like in Concord, while comprehending that nobody can assure approval days. A qualified carrier will provide a realistic variety, explain where delays generally take place, and maintain you educated if timelines shift. Vague assurances of a lightning-fast install are less useful than an honest explanation of the process.

This is another area where local experience assists. Solar companies that work regularly in the area tend to recognize what documentation is typically called for and where projects can get stuck. That does not make them ideal, however it often decreases preventable friction.

Watch for cost savings asserts that are too neat

When a proposal states your expense will disappear or your system will pay for itself in a set number of years, decrease. Electrical energy prices transform. House use changes. Weather varies from year to year. Even exceptional solar manufacturing designs count on assumptions.

A reasonable carrier will speak in ranges. They will explain that actual cost savings depend on manufacturing, usage patterns, price structures, and any future electrification changes in the home. They need to also clarify the distinction between offsetting yearly kilowatt-hours and minimizing high-cost usage at pricey times of day. Those relate, but not similar, goals.

This is specifically crucial when assessing financed projects. Some discussions make the month-to-month financing payment really feel lower than your existing costs, then build the rest of the debate around predicted utility rising cost of living. That might exercise, but it is still a projection. The company ought to not present it as a certainty.

Frequently Ask Questions about Solar Providers in Concord, CA


How much do solar providers charge for installation in Concord?

Residential solar installation typically costs between $15,000 and $35,000 before incentives. The final price depends on system size, equipment quality, roof configuration, and labor requirements. Larger systems designed to offset more electricity usage generally cost more. Available tax credits and incentives can reduce the overall cost.

Are solar providers worth the investment in Concord?

Solar providers can help homeowners install systems that generate electricity and reduce reliance on utility power. The value of the investment depends on electricity rates, household energy consumption, system performance, and available incentives. Many systems continue producing electricity for 25 years or longer. Individual savings and returns vary by household.

Do solar providers offer financing or leasing options in Concord?

Many solar providers offer financing options such as solar loans, leases, and power purchase agreements. These programs can reduce or eliminate upfront costs by spreading payments over time. Terms, interest rates, and ownership structures vary between providers. Reviewing financing details helps homeowners understand the total long-term cost.

What services are included with a solar provider in Concord?

Solar providers typically offer site evaluations, system design, permitting, equipment procurement, installation, inspections, and utility interconnection. Some also provide battery storage integration, monitoring tools, and warranty support. Services may vary depending on the provider and project scope. Most providers manage the installation process from start to finish.

What warranties do solar providers offer in Concord?

Solar warranties often include equipment, workmanship, and performance coverage. Product warranties commonly range from 10 to 25 years, while performance warranties may guarantee energy production for 25 years or more. Workmanship warranties cover installation-related issues for a specified period. Coverage details vary among manufacturers and installers.

Are local solar providers better than national companies in Concord?

Both local and national solar providers can deliver quality installations and customer support. Local providers may offer greater familiarity with regional permitting requirements, while national companies may have broader resources and product selections. Installation quality and warranty coverage are often more important than company size. Homeowners should compare credentials and service offerings before choosing a provider.

How long does installation take with a solar provider in Concord?

The physical installation of a residential solar system usually takes one to three days. However, the complete process, including design, permitting, inspections, and utility approvals, often takes several weeks. Project complexity and local regulations can affect timelines. Larger or custom-designed systems may require additional time.

Do solar providers handle permits and utility approvals in Concord?

Most solar providers manage permits, inspections, and utility interconnection as part of the installation process. These steps help ensure compliance with local building and electrical codes. Providers typically coordinate with permitting agencies and utility companies on behalf of the homeowner. Specific services may vary by provider.

What solar panel brands do solar providers use in Concord?

Solar providers typically offer panels from multiple manufacturers with different efficiency ratings, warranties, and performance characteristics. Available options may include premium, mid-range, and budget-friendly products. The choice of panel often depends on energy goals, roof space, and budget. Providers generally recommend equipment based on project requirements.

Can solar providers help reduce electricity bills in Concord?

Solar energy systems can lower electricity bills by generating power that offsets energy purchased from the utility grid. The amount of savings depends on system size, household energy use, utility rates, and available sunlight. Many homeowners experience reduced monthly electricity costs after installation. Actual savings vary based on individual circumstances and system performance.
